Philip Marshall was the founder of Conversa Health, Inc. which was founded in 2013, where he held the title of Director & Chief Product Officer.
Currently, he is a Director at Health Enterprises Network.
In the past, he worked as SVP-Hospice Strategy & Development at LHC Group, Inc.

Medical/Nursing ServicesHealth Services LHC Group, Inc. engages in the provision of post-acute health care services to patients through its home nursing agencies, hospitals, and long-term acute care hospitals. It operates through the following segments: Home Health, Hospice, Home and Community-based, Facility-based, and HCI. The Home Based segment offers services through nursing, medically-oriented social services, and physical, occupational and speech therapy. The Hospice includes pain and symptom management, emotional and spiritual support, inpatient and respite care, homemaker services, and counseling. The Home and Community-based involves in providing assistance to elderly, chronically ill, and disabled patients with activities of daily living. The Facility-based segments operates LTACH. The HCI segment reports developmental activities outside its other business segments. The company was founded by Keith G. Myers in September 1994 and is headquartered in Lafayette, LA. | Health Services |
